Sciatica is not a condition itself — it's a symptom of nerve compression. The sciatic nerve runs from your lower back down each leg, and when compressed, it causes shooting pain, tingling, numbness, and weakness. Rheumatoid arthritis is an autoimmune condition that causes chronic inflammation of the joints. While there is no cure, it can be managed effectively through gentle movement, manual therapy, and lifestyle modifications that reduce inflammation and maintain joint function.

Following viral infections like dengue, chikungunya, or COVID-19, many patients experience persistent joint pain and inflammation. This post-viral arthritis can be debilitating, but with the right rehabilitation protocol, most patients recover fully.

Heel pain — most commonly plantar fasciitis — affects millions of people, especially those who spend long hours standing or are physically active. The pain is often worst with the first steps in the morning, making daily life difficult.

Ankle sprains are among the most common injuries — and when not properly rehabilitated, they can lead to chronic instability, recurrent injury, and long-term pain. Proper rehabilitation is essential for full recovery.

Tennis elbow (lateral epicondylitis) is a painful condition caused by overuse of the forearm muscles. Despite its name, it affects far more than tennis players — anyone whose work involves repetitive wrist and arm movements can develop it.

Temporomandibular joint (TMJ) disorders affect the jaw joint and surrounding muscles, causing pain, clicking, difficulty chewing, and often headaches. Many TMJ issues originate from postural or cervical spine dysfunction.

Avascular necrosis (AVN) of the hip occurs when blood flow to the femoral head is disrupted, causing bone death and eventually collapse. While often leading to hip replacement, conservative management can help preserve joint function and delay or avoid surgery.

Spondylolisthesis occurs when one vertebra slips forward over the one below it, often causing back pain, stiffness, and sometimes nerve compression. Conservative treatment focusing on core stabilization can effectively manage symptoms and prevent progression.

Fibromyalgia is characterized by widespread musculoskeletal pain, fatigue, sleep disturbances, and tender points. While the cause isn't fully understood, gentle movement, manual therapy, stress management, and lifestyle support can significantly improve quality of life.

Cervical spondylosis is age-related wear and tear of the neck vertebrae and discs. While it's common, it doesn't have to mean chronic pain. Through gentle mobilization, strengthening, and postural correction, most patients can manage symptoms effectively and maintain an active life.
